Hi Debbie, glad to hear the anxiety is a bit more under control. I have taken tramadol on a few occasions and its pretty mild as far as pain meds go. Pretty much all pain meds can worsen c but I agree that this would be worth a try as it is the most mild. You can always take it with some stool softeners it you seem to be getting more C.

I avoid all the codeine stuff as it makes me nauseous and very sick to my tummy!

I have recently switched back from D to C. I think one of my meds I was taken was causing the explosive D. However, I now find myself taking two stool softners in the am and two in the pm. I have a ton of miralax left over from before but right now, the stool softeners seem to be working ok.

Another idea would be to ask about Cymbalta. C is listed as a side effect but it is an antidepressant that also helps with pain. I have yet to try it but I have heard many good things about it!
